Industrial Demand Factors
The demand for silver comes from both investment and its industrial applications. It’s used in electronics, solar panels, and medical devices. As these areas grow, so does the need for silver, which could push its price up and make it more appealing to investors.
- Electronics: Silver is used in the manufacture of components due to its high conductivity.
- Solar Panels: Silver’s role in photovoltaic cells makes it key for renewable energy.
- Medical Devices: Silver’s antimicrobial properties make it valuable in medical applications.

Tax Implications of Precious Metal Investments
When you look into investing in precious metals, knowing about taxes is key. Gold, silver, and platinum can add variety to your portfolio. But, it’s important to know the tax rules for these investments.
Current Tax Regulations
In India, taxes on precious metal investments depend on the metal type, investment form, and holding time. For example, capital gains tax kicks in when you sell your metals. If sold within 36 months, the gains are short-term capital gains and taxed based on your income tax slab.
If held over 36 months, the gains are long-term capital gains. These are taxed at 20% with indexation benefits.
Strategic Tax Planning for Metal Investors
To cut down on taxes, smart tax planning is essential. Holding onto your investments for over 36 months can lead to lower tax rates. Also, investing in tax-saving instruments or Sovereign Gold Bonds can offer tax perks.

Hallmarking Standards and Regulations
Hallmarking is key in India’s gold jewelry world. It proves the jewelry is real and of good quality. Always choose hallmarked pieces.
The Bureau of Indian Standards (BIS) oversees hallmarking. BIS hallmarking checks gold purity and marks it with a symbol. This shows the gold’s karat value.
Price Composition and Making Charges
Knowing how gold jewelry prices are set is important. The cost depends on gold value, making charges, and design complexity. Brand reputation also plays a role.
Making charges differ among jewelers. It’s smart to compare prices. Some jewelers give discounts on making charges, like during festivals.

Authenticating and Valuing Your Precious Metals
It’s key to check if your precious metals are real and worth their price. This is true whether you’re buying, selling, or keeping them. It protects your money and makes sure you follow the rules.
Verification Methods and Tools
To check if metals are real, you can try different ways. Acid tests are often used to see if gold and silver are pure. X-Ray Fluorescence (XRF) tech also helps with exact checks. And, hallmarking and certification from places like the Bureau of Indian Standards (BIS) are trusted.
Getting precious metal testing kits is also smart. These kits have acids and a touchstone to test purity.
